I started to play Germany and crashed after reloading saved games today, regardless of automatic saved games or any other manually saved game. I started the scenario in rtw2 yesterday and saved it.
Its the Hitler 1936 "free game scenario" and I used the world-builder option (*shame on me*, I only wanted a few more fighters), but i think thats not the reason cause I played about 4 houres without any trouble.
On my XP machine with sp2 the error message told me something about "msvcp71.dll". Thats a file in the civ4 folder. I turned the game on my vista laptop and can play after reloading, but another error message there told me something like "kann speicherdaten nicht komprimieren" (cannot compress memory data, sorry for my bad translation).
I tried to save it today and checked the folder, the saved game is about 4350 bytes instead of normally 950k from yesterday !!! (I was in the early 1938).
Well, Im no software expert, but maybe something happened in the game yesterday with memory management while saving it, I hope you will fix that and that I dont have to restart my scenario again, Im well on the run with germany until now
